    Using Two Princesses?

    Thread title says it. I've manged to obtain the two plat Princesses that general consensus seems to state are fairly good-- Lilia the defensive oriented one, and Sherry the offensive oriented one. I myself have been using this duo (who I've been calling the Princess twins) almost constantly, especially once starting the desert maps. I have all of two other units that have CC'd, and the rest are kind of soft against the desert foes (those damn mummies hurt!). So I've been dropping down my two Princesses as soon as I can every map, plop Flamel down behind them as an emergency tank/healer and go to town. I guess my question is, is using two Princesses a waste of one of my slots and time? I don't seem to have any issues clearing desert maps for now, but kind of wanted to get the opinions of people who have been playing longer.

    One of the beauties of this game is that there are many ways to play it. If your twin princess tactics works for you then roll with it!

    Just be mindful of early rush maps, where relatively high cost of that combo might not allow to unleash it early enough to catch all, and remember that Princesses deal magic damage, so beware of high-MR enemies.)

    For starters, these princesses really shine best when AW'd. Since it sounds like you're not at that point yet, I'd advise you to focus on CC'ing your other units first.

    As much as I love Lilia, you'll want to AW Sherry first, due to her "golden army" passive (boost all gold-rarity stats by 5%, and supposedly units below that rarity as well).

    AW Lilia is a longer investment, particularly since she becomes godly with SAW. At AW though, she's a very respectable duelist, and her HP-regen passive can give her some leeway with letting her tank things without a dedicated healer for a short while.

    There's no reason to regret leveling both of them quite a bit although Awakening them both is a bit sketchy. A convenient thing about princesses is that unlike most other plats they don't require lighting 3 silver units on fire to reach max affection and the equivalent of 50cc70 stats. Thanks to her inherent tankiness Lilia in particular shines as a 2nd or 3rd string duelist that can help power you through the story maps and still make cameo appearances in maps like Golden Armor G even if you never bother to max her out.
